SCRIPTURE
Proverbs 3:5-6

Trust in the LORD with all your heart and lean not on your own understanding; 6 in all your ways acknowledge him, and he will make your paths straight.

FOOD FOR THOUGHT
When we lean to our own understanding we miss God’s will. Our minds can’t begin to understand or conceive why God does what He does. Even when things in our lives seem hopeless and we feel helpless, we must still be obedient to God’s will. We must continue to trust Him and acknowledge Him in all that we do so His promises can be fulfilled.

APPLICATION
Close your eyes and meditate on a time when all hope was gone. Now think about how God showed up in that situation, strengthened and sustained you. You made it even when others thought you wouldn’t but God knew you would.

PRAYER
Lord, you are all powerful and all knowing. You know all about me, you know what’s in my heart. Help me to accept you as head of my life. Show me how to trust you even when I don’t understand.

SCRIPTURE
Proverbs 19:21

Many are the plans in a man's heart, but it is the LORD's purpose that prevails.

FOOD FOR THOUGHT
We all have made plans for our life, our marriages, and our children. How many of our plans have come to pass? How many times have we thanked God for not giving us what we asked for or for blocking or shutting a door that we tried to open? How many times has God used what we planned for ourselves to bless others?

APPLICATION
What were the plans for your life 5, 10, or even 20 years ago? Did they come to pass or did God use what you planned to accomplish something far better in your life?

PRAYER
Lord, you are the King of Kings and the Lord of Lords and I thank you for changing my plans to accomplish your purpose. Please use me for the building of you kingdom and help me to accept your will and not my wants.

SCRIPTURE
1 Corinthians 2:9

But as it is written: "Eye has not seen, nor ear heard, Nor have entered into the heart of man the things which God has prepared for those who love Him."

FOOD FOR THOUGHT
God promises blessings to those who love Him far beyond what we can imagine. We will never understand with our natural senses the things God has for us. Only the Holy Spirit can reveal God’s wisdom as we desire to have the mind of Christ.

APPLICATION
Pray and thank God for giving you more than you can imagine. Pray for His wisdom and revelation of His Word. Expect God to give you more than you ask. Now ask God to show you how you can be a blessing to His kingdom with what He has given you.

PRAYER
Father God how awesome you are. I thank you in advance for my not yet, and trust you to give me far beyond what I could ever imagine. Help me to bless others with what you give to me.

SCRIPTURE
2 Corinthians 4:18

So we fix our eyes not on what is seen, but on what is unseen. For what is seen is temporary, but what is unseen is eternal.

FOOD FOR
THOUGHT

No matter what your situation is at this time it is only temporal. Life is temporal, cars and money are temporal, hurt and pain is temporal, but the things which we can’t see, those which are spiritual are eternal. We must trust in things we can’t see; Faith, God’s Holiness, and our salvation are things to rejoice about because they give us what we can’t see in this life time-eternal life.

APPLICATION
Make a list of things that make you happy. Do they give you peace of mind? What is most important to you, cars, money, jewelry or having a relationship with God? Are helping the less fortunate and building God’s kingdom important to you?

PRAYER
Father God, thank you for loving us in spite of all that we have done. Thank you for giving us your peace that surpasses all human understanding. Help us to cherish you more and more each day as we seek your will, your way and purpose.
